Agreement clears way for educational progress
Education Minister Hekia Parata has welcomed
an agreement between the Ministry of Education and the New
Zealand Educational Institute Te Riu Roa on how schools will
work together to lift student achievement.
The agreement follows discussions between the Ministry and NZEI on collaboration between schools that will target educational challenges and improve teaching and leadership practices.
“I’m delighted with this agreement and want to thank all those who have worked over many months and who share my commitment to making sure every child can reach their full potential.
“This agreement follows one reached with secondary unions and represents a clear way forward for schools to work in communities, helping build on the progress already made to share knowledge and best practice among teachers and principals.
“We know that the quality of teaching and leadership are the most important in-school factors when it comes to education. It’s great that both primary and secondary unions will be involved in the work to make this happen,” says Ms Parata.
As a result of the agreement with the NZEI, communities of schools will expand to Communities of Learning which will include the pathway from early childhood on through to tertiary options.
Communities of Learning will be funded as part of the Government’s $359 million Investing in Educational Success initiative, announced in 2014.
NZEI will be taking details of the agreement to its members this week.
